Executive Summary
Finance ERP implementation governance becomes difficult when headquarters wants standardization but local entities must comply with country-specific tax, statutory reporting, banking, language, currency and approval requirements. The core executive challenge is not whether to choose a global template or local flexibility. It is how to govern both without creating a fragmented finance landscape, uncontrolled customization, weak controls or delayed rollouts. A strong governance model defines what is globally mandatory, what is locally configurable and what requires formal exception approval.
For Odoo programs, this means treating implementation as an enterprise operating model decision, not only a software deployment. Governance should cover discovery, business process analysis, gap analysis, solution architecture, functional and technical design, configuration standards, customization rules, OCA module evaluation, integrations, data migration, testing, training, change management, go-live and continuous improvement. In multi-company environments, the finance template must preserve comparability across entities while allowing local compliance and practical execution. The most successful programs establish a design authority, a clear RACI, a template backlog, a local deviation register and measurable release governance from day one.
What should executive governance decide before design begins?
Before workshops start, executives should decide the non-negotiables of the finance operating model. These include the target level of process harmonization, the ownership of the chart of accounts, intercompany policy, shared services scope, approval authority, reporting hierarchy, close calendar, tax control model and the acceptable level of local deviation. Without these decisions, implementation teams often confuse unresolved policy questions with system gaps.
A practical governance structure usually includes an executive steering committee, a finance design authority, an enterprise architecture board and a country or business-unit council. The steering committee resolves business trade-offs. The design authority protects the global template. Enterprise architecture governs integrations, security, cloud deployment and scalability. Local councils validate statutory and operational fit. This separation prevents every local request from becoming a platform exception.
| Governance domain | Global decision | Local decision | Escalation trigger |
|---|---|---|---|
| Finance process model | Record-to-report, procure-to-pay and order-to-cash standards | Country-specific approval routing where legally required | Process change affecting group controls or reporting |
| Master data | Global naming, coding, ownership and quality rules | Local enrichment fields for tax or banking | New data objects or duplicate ownership |
| Chart of accounts | Group structure, consolidation mapping and reporting dimensions | Local statutory mapping and tax accounts | Request to alter group reporting logic |
| Technology | Core Odoo version, hosting model, integration standards and security baseline | Peripheral local banking or e-invoicing adapters | Custom code impacting upgradeability or security |
How should discovery and assessment be structured for a global finance template?
Discovery should begin with business outcomes, not module selection. Leadership should define why the program exists: faster close, stronger compliance, lower operating cost, better cash visibility, improved intercompany control, standardized approvals or a platform for acquisitions. These outcomes shape the implementation methodology and determine where standardization creates value.
Assessment should then map current-state finance processes across representative entities rather than every entity at once. A useful pattern is to select archetypes such as headquarters, shared services, manufacturing subsidiary, distribution entity and newly acquired company. This reveals where differences are structural and where they are historical workarounds. Business process analysis should document process variants, control points, local legal obligations, reporting outputs, integration dependencies and pain points. Gap analysis should classify findings into four categories: adopt the global template, configure locally, extend through approved modules, or redesign the business process.
- Identify mandatory global controls first: period close, segregation of duties, intercompany rules, approval thresholds, audit trail and reporting dimensions.
- Separate legal requirements from preference-based requests to avoid unnecessary localization.
- Assess country-specific tax, invoicing, withholding, banking and document retention obligations early.
- Document upstream and downstream dependencies with procurement, sales, inventory, manufacturing, payroll and banking systems where relevant.
What does a sound solution architecture look like for global and local finance needs?
The solution architecture should define a stable core and controlled extension layers. In Odoo, the stable core typically includes Accounting and, where the business case supports it, Documents, Purchase, Sales, Inventory, Expenses, Approvals through workflow design, Spreadsheet for controlled reporting support and Knowledge for policy distribution. Multi-company management should be designed intentionally, especially for shared vendors, intercompany transactions, centralized treasury and group reporting.
Functional design should specify the global process blueprint, approval matrices, accounting policies, tax determination logic, payment controls, reconciliation approach, reporting dimensions and exception handling. Technical design should define environments, identity and access management, integration patterns, audit logging, backup, observability and release controls. Where local requirements exceed standard capabilities, teams should evaluate whether configuration, a vetted OCA module or a targeted extension is the right answer. OCA module evaluation should consider maintainability, community maturity, security review, upgrade impact and fit with the enterprise support model.
An API-first architecture is especially important when finance depends on external banking, tax engines, e-invoicing networks, procurement platforms, payroll systems, data warehouses or legacy operational systems. APIs reduce brittle point-to-point dependencies and support phased modernization. For cloud ERP deployments, architecture should also address enterprise scalability and operational resilience. If the organization requires containerized deployment, Kubernetes and Docker may be relevant for environment consistency and release management, while PostgreSQL, Redis, monitoring and observability become important for performance, queue handling and operational support. These choices should be driven by business continuity, supportability and partner operating model, not technical fashion.
How do you control configuration, customization and localization without losing upgradeability?
The most common governance failure in global ERP programs is allowing local requirements to bypass design authority and become custom code. A better model is to define a configuration-first policy, a localization catalog and a customization threshold. Configuration should be used for company structures, journals, taxes, fiscal positions, approval routing, payment terms, currencies, analytic dimensions and reporting views where standard capabilities are sufficient. Localization should be packaged as reusable country patterns rather than one-off entity builds.
Customization should be approved only when the requirement is legally necessary, competitively differentiating or materially risk-reducing. Even then, the design should minimize core overrides and preserve upgrade paths. Odoo Studio can be appropriate for controlled low-code extensions, but governance should still require documentation, test coverage and ownership. For enterprise programs, every extension should have a business owner, a technical owner, a retirement review date and a release impact assessment.
| Requirement type | Preferred response | Governance rationale | Typical owner |
|---|---|---|---|
| Global finance standard | Core configuration in template | Maximizes consistency and reporting comparability | Finance design authority |
| Country compliance need | Localized configuration or approved module | Supports legal fit without fragmenting the core | Local finance lead with central review |
| Unique operational preference | Challenge and redesign process first | Avoids unnecessary complexity | Process owner |
| Strategic differentiator or legal gap | Targeted extension with controls | Justifies lifecycle cost and testing effort | Executive sponsor and architecture board |
What integration, data and control decisions matter most in finance rollout governance?
Finance ERP programs fail quietly when integrations and data are treated as technical workstreams instead of governance priorities. Integration strategy should identify systems of record, event ownership, reconciliation points, error handling and support responsibilities. For example, if procurement, payroll, banking, tax reporting or business intelligence platforms remain external, executives need clarity on which platform owns each transaction state and which controls prove completeness and accuracy.
Data migration strategy should prioritize opening balances, open items, supplier and customer masters, tax data, bank accounts, fixed assets where applicable and historical data needed for audit or operational continuity. Master data governance is essential in multi-company implementations because duplicate vendors, inconsistent payment terms, conflicting tax identifiers and uncontrolled chart mappings can undermine both compliance and analytics. Data ownership should be assigned by domain, with quality rules, approval workflows and cutover checkpoints.
Security governance should include role design, segregation of duties, privileged access control, approval traceability and identity lifecycle management. Identity and access management should align with enterprise standards, especially where single sign-on, federation or managed identities are required. Security testing should validate not only vulnerabilities but also control design, role conflicts and audit evidence. In finance, a technically secure platform can still be operationally weak if approval bypasses, posting rights or payment controls are poorly designed.
How should testing, training and change management be governed across countries?
Testing should be organized around business risk, not only feature completion. User Acceptance Testing should validate end-to-end finance scenarios such as invoice-to-payment, order-to-cash posting, intercompany settlement, period close, tax reporting, bank reconciliation, credit note handling and exception approvals. Performance testing matters when shared services teams process high transaction volumes, large imports, scheduled postings or concurrent close activities. Country-specific scenarios should be included, but the test model should remain anchored in the global template.
Training strategy should distinguish between policy education, process training and system execution. Finance leaders often underestimate the need to explain why the template exists, what local teams can and cannot change, and how support will work after go-live. Organizational change management should therefore include stakeholder mapping, country readiness assessments, super-user networks, communication plans and adoption metrics. - Use scenario-based UAT scripts tied to controls, not generic click-path testing.
- Require local sign-off on statutory scenarios and central sign-off on template integrity.
- Train super-users on exception handling, not only normal transactions.
- Measure readiness through data quality, role assignment, test completion and support preparedness.
What should go-live, hypercare and business continuity planning include?
Go-live planning should define cutover ownership, freeze windows, migration checkpoints, rollback criteria, reconciliation procedures, communication protocols and executive decision thresholds. In finance, cutover is not only a technical event. It is a control event. Teams should confirm opening balances, open payables and receivables, bank connectivity, approval routing, tax logic, reporting outputs and user access before production release.
Hypercare support should be structured around issue severity, business impact, country escalation and daily control reviews. The first weeks after go-live should monitor posting failures, integration exceptions, payment blocks, reconciliation mismatches, performance bottlenecks and user access issues. Business continuity planning should cover backup and recovery, incident response, key-person dependency, cloud resilience and fallback procedures for critical finance operations. Where cloud ERP is deployed on managed infrastructure, operational governance should include monitoring, observability, database health, queue performance and release discipline. How do executives measure ROI without oversimplifying the business case?
The ROI of finance ERP governance is rarely captured by license or hosting cost alone. The stronger business case usually comes from reduced close effort, lower audit friction, fewer manual reconciliations, improved cash visibility, faster entity onboarding, better intercompany control, lower customization debt and more reliable management reporting. Workflow automation opportunities may include invoice routing, approval escalations, payment proposal controls, exception alerts, document capture and recurring close tasks. AI-assisted implementation opportunities can support requirements classification, test case generation, document analysis, data quality review and support triage, but they should remain under human governance, especially for finance controls and compliance-sensitive decisions.
Executives should track value through operational KPIs and governance KPIs together. Examples include close cycle duration, percentage of template adoption, number of approved local deviations, data quality scores, integration incident rates, audit findings, support ticket trends and time to onboard a new entity. This creates a more realistic view of modernization progress than a narrow budget-versus-plan lens.
Executive recommendations and future trends
First, define the finance operating model before debating software features. Second, establish a design authority with real decision rights over template integrity, local exceptions and release governance. Third, treat data, controls and integrations as board-level implementation risks, not downstream technical tasks. Fourth, package localization as reusable patterns to support multi-company growth and acquisitions. Fifth, align cloud deployment strategy with supportability, resilience and compliance obligations rather than infrastructure preference alone.
Looking ahead, finance ERP governance will increasingly converge with enterprise architecture, analytics and automation governance. More organizations will expect API-led interoperability, stronger auditability, embedded analytics, policy-driven access control and AI-assisted operational support. The winners will not be those with the most customized finance platform, but those with the clearest governance model for balancing global consistency and local accountability.
